Cardiff's pub theatre The Other Room, is once again throwing open its doors to the theatre makers of tomorrow with its fifth Young Artists Festival, which will run 08 - 13 April.

Following the success and sell out performances of last year's festival, The Other Room are now inviting applications from new and emerging actors, directors, writers and stage managers for this year's festival. Successful applicants will benefit from a week long programme of workshops, masterclasses, mentorship and professional support from key figures in the industry including playwright Meredydd Barker, Director Simon Harris, Simon Curtis from Equity, Maggie Dunning from Arts Council of Wales and a casting Q&A with Nicola Reynolds and Mawgaine Tarrant-Cornish. Additionally, Artistic Director Dan Jones and Executive Director Bizzy Day will be on hand to share their expertise throughout the week. Topics covered will include fundraising, diversity in the arts, working with industry unions, creating a company and professional production management.

The week will culminate in the formation of six new companies assembled to produce, direct and perform six brand new ten-minute plays specially commissioned from six British playwrights by The Other Room for the festival. The writers are Brad Birch, Isley Lynn, Roger Williams, Lisa Parry, Owen Thomas and Nerida Bradley. The young writers attached to each company will also write a ten-minute play in response to their experiences over the week and these will be performed on the Saturday afternoon as a series of readings.
